Copenhagen Essay Topics

1.

The play takes place after the death of all three main characters. How does this affect the story’s narrative perspective? What impact does the characters’ deaths have on the story being told?


2.

Heisenberg is proud of his country and wants to protect his fellow Germans. How does his nationalism inform his actions?


3.

Margrethe plays an important role in the story. How does she function as both a character and a mediator?
